After searching web and forum a bit i didnt find what ive wanted. And my question is about pet. Do they have any kind of cap on how much we can train them ? Atm im leveling him to use him to help my alts a bit and in future probably i will use him on hunter (a class that im interested in ) but i dont know how much i can train him in one stat to max it(if it can be maxed) or its better to distribute it across all his stats.

Attack and crit are the stats you want on pet. everything else are just silver sinks and are there for fluff. And i think you’ll hit silver cap way before you could max a stat (if its even possible).

and what about accuracy? its useless? ive trained some point in there on my pet

mostly useless. your pet wont miss monsters if they are around pet’s level.

If they have that much money they’ll probably get a ban for some kind of abuse/exploit. Price for next training of same attribute increases by 7% compared to previous one. If you decide to train one stat of pet every level then by level 600 your training will cost 1.07^600 * base_price.

For example: cheapest stat training starts at ~250 silver, by level 600 you will have to pay 106,710,368,537,475,956,151 silver to increase that stat by 1.

atm max pet lvl is around 400 but even if itll cost so much…there is also pet “gear” probably not implemented yet. I know pet is a money sink but i feel there/should be a cap for stats like with skill upgrade on our chars and i want to know (if there is a cap) where te cap is

with exponential growth of price while the stat growth is linear they just might not implement a cap to begin with.

Also by the looks of things maximum amount of silver player can have is about 2.147b (4-byte integer). Now it shouldnt be hard to calculate the cap for stat has starting cost of 250: it is about 236.
